Imagine sharing part of a private island and staying in the former home of Gavin Maxwell, author of the classic book "Ring of Bright Water". Gavin Maxwell Cottage on Eilean Ban situated between Kyleankin on Skye and the Kyle of Lochalsh, on the Scottish mainland, has this unique claim to fame. Once only accessible by boat, after the building of the Skye Bridge this former lighthouse keeper's cottage is now accessed via a private door on the side of the Syke Bridge. Eilean Ban (Gaelic for White Island) is 6 acres of pure heaven. Small stone paths meander around the island with colourful shrubs, herbs, heathers and wild grasses covering the hillsides. Gavin Maxwell was one of the foremost authors of wildlife books of the last century, and now his legacy can be enjoyed by all. the island boasts a wonderful array of wildlife. There are frequent sightings of otters, seals and pine martin, as well as occasional dolphins, porpoises, basking sharks and Minke whales, together with an array of seabirds.

There is a superb, award-winning designed thatched wildlife hide perched on the hillside that provides a wonderful vantage point to watch the rich variety of birdlife, including Eider Ducks and a heronry on the adjoining island. Visitors are welcome to take an escorted tour of the Stevenson Lighthouse that is situated on the shoreline. This unique and historic island offers the ultimate retreat, yet is easily accessible, as it is situated on the gateway to Isle of Skye, with all its amazing scenery, historic sites and unspoilt, wild countryside this island has to offer. The cottage is spacious and well-equipped. The large farmhouse style kitchen / dining room looks out across the sea to the myriad of small islands dotted along the shoreline. The cosy sitting-room has a lovely fireplace with wood-burning stove and the two bedrooms are both generous in size and very well presented. The adjoining Long Room (access is via a separate door) houses the Gavin Maxwell Museum. Recreated by the actress Virginia McKenna and others, and now run by the Eilean Ban Trust, it is a reconstruction of Gavin’s 40’ living room. This interesting museum is a testament to Maxwell’s fascinating life and contains unique writings and artefacts;
